Twisted Reveries II: Tales From Willoughby  by Meg Hafdahl 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 My Ratings 4.4/5 GO GRAB YOUR COPY VIA AMAZON Synopsis Suspense author, Meg Hafdahl, delivers another collection of spine-tingling stories in this second volume of the Twisted Reveries series. Inspired by the first book's Willoughby and Moira Kettlesburg stories, Meg takes us on a journey into the mid-western town of Willoughby where forgetting is a way of life. Delve into its macabre history and origins. Explore the strange and unsettling events that plague Willoughby's unsuspecting citizens in this new collection of thirteen horrifically outstanding tales. Lipstick Asylum  by Nzondi 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 My Ratings 4.4/5 GO GRAB YOUR COPY VIA AMAZON Synopsis The Scream Teens are hired to raise the dead as the necro-tainment for a zombie cruise, and the eighteen-year-old animator, Cozy Coleman, is bitten by a shapeshifting she-wolf. To Cozy’s surprise, she survives and with the aid of her friends, helps the government stop a human-extinction virus from spreading. Unfortunately, Cozy uncovers a secret so haunting, that her death is only the beginning of her problems. My Thoughts I read this book in 2 days, that's how good it was.
